Wow!!!! Another fantastic finish (if you are rooting for Stanford). They scored 8 runs in two innings to run rule LSU, 8-0. The trees scored 7 in the 5th and in the 6th, their first batter hit the 1st pitch out of the stadium for the walk off win. As the announcers said, it was chaos in the 5th.

The WCWS matchups are:
Stanford v Texas
Duke v OU
Alabama v UCLA
OK State v Florida
Games start Thursday at noon ET

Conference representation
3 Big12, 2 SEC, 2 PAC12, 1 ACC

It took 13 SEC teams in the playoffs just to get 2 to the WCWS...again. That seems to happen every year. SEC teams ARE NOT better than teams from other conferences. It's just a crime what the selection committee does year after year after year. Pac 12 also got 2 with only about half as many teams in the field, and Big 12 got 3 with less than half as many included.

And of the 13, 8 of them hosted Regionals. No other conference had more than 3 teams hosting. Even with the deck ridiculously stacked in their favor, the SEC can't deliver. Year after year after year.
